By Belize Live News Staff: A Sunday evening traffic accident near the San Lorenzo roundabout, Orange Walk District left two vehicles damaged after a Ford Ranger reportedly collided into the rear of a Toyota Matrix.
Police say the collision involved a red Ford Ranger (LP A3330) and a blue Toyota Matrix (LP D00635). The Ranger suffered bumper damage, a broken headlight and indicator, and a flat front tire. The Matrix sustained major rear damage including a dislodged bumper, broken back glass, and damage to the rear trunk.
The Ford Ranger was reportedly driven by Ian Bryan Dawson, 21, who told police the Matrix suddenly attempted to turn left into his lane without signaling. Dawson said he tried braking, but the pickup slid and struck the Matrix.
The Toyota Matrix was driven by Juan Enrique Rodriquez, 49, a taxi driver from Trial Farm Village, Orange Walk, who reportedly accepted responsibility. Both drivers agreed to settle the matter through insurance.
Police processed the area and completed a sketch plan. Both drivers were instructed to report to the Trial Farm Police Sub-Station.
